文章詳情頁
mysql新建字段時 timestamp NOT NULL DEFAULT ’0000-00-00 00:00:00’ 報錯
瀏覽:140日期:2022-06-20 17:35:56
問題描述
問題解答
回答1:5.7開始默認就不允許這種默認值了,建議查一下官網(wǎng)文檔。
回答2:建議用int來保存時間
回答3:你的timestamp字段類型是什么?ps:另外樓上提到int格式非所有場景下都為最優(yōu)
回答4:timestamp支持年份范圍有限,但占用字節(jié)為2,datetime可以支持0000到9999,但占用字節(jié)數(shù)為4
相關(guān)文章:
1. thinkphp5.1學習時遇到session問題2. docker網(wǎng)絡端口映射,沒有方便點的操作方法么?3. docker容器呢SSH為什么連不通呢?4. angular.js - angular內(nèi)容過長展開收起效果5. nignx - docker內(nèi)nginx 80端口被占用6. docker綁定了nginx端口 外部訪問不到7. docker images顯示的鏡像過多,狗眼被亮瞎了,怎么辦?8. javascript - iframe 為什么加載網(wǎng)頁的時候滾動條這樣顯示?9. 前端 - ng-view不能加載進模板10. php - 第三方支付平臺在很短時間內(nèi)多次異步通知,訂單多次確認收款
排行榜

熱門標簽